PERSPECTIVE: Only forgiveness can snuff the destructive flames of war - Opinion: "War is a waste of resources. It is a waste of human energy and talent, a waste of money that that could have been spent on education, health or other important domestic issues and a waste of time. Wars never solve problems, they just create new ones. They only create situations on the ground that will remain as long as the force that created them exists and, the moment this force gets weaker, old and new situations arise. It is cooperation and forgiveness that allow humanity to continue despite the mistakes of war. The 'losers' forgive the 'winners' or they are just waiting for the right moment to retaliate.
War is a stupid, uncreative, uncivilized, backward and primitive act. It is like people solving their problems in the town by beating each other instead of going to the police. The world is just a large town and we are all citizens in this world.
All wars should be criminalized and considered acts of terrorism regardless of the agenda of those who want to start them. The United Nations should have an international police force to stop aggressors and try them publicly in the court of international law. The United Nations should be reformed. Finally, I suggest an international day of apology in which individuals and countries apologize for the wrongs they did to other nations and individuals. A new education of responsibility and creative problem-solving should be introduced in the culture, not just the education of violence, revenge and power.
We need to build our children from psychological material that is not flammable, that will not catch fire when someone comes with a good speech or smart ideology and try to start the fires of war. Look inside yourself and see what flammable material"
Is it nationalism, racism, fear, anger or is it just loss of hope in your life and its meaning? Wars can create pride and meaning for a short while, but after that, one will be left with the truth: One human life is not worth more than another, and wars will not make anyone live for eternity. Justice brings peace, wars just creates lies.
Majed Ashy is a psychology lecturer at Boston University MET College and a research fellow of psychiatry at Harvard Medical School
